LCD monitor internal power supply repair
Hi,
I"ve got a Northgate 17" LCD monitor who's warranty expired the 4th and just gave out on me! Go figure - 15 days after the warranty dies... I have isolated the problem to the internal power supply but need help determining the exact problem. THe problem is intermittant. When the problem does occur, the 100 uF, 400 Volt capacitor buzzes. At first I thought it was the capacitor (on the ac incoming (primary) side. But I think the capacitor may be just reacting to a fluctuating power level - maybe from a bad step down transformer. I desoldered the capacitor and plugged the monitor in. It buzzed - but only once - as opposed to several times with the capacitor in place. Any suggestions or ideas to look would be appreciated.
